The Wire-Free Illusion: What They Don’t Tell You

Let’s get one thing straight upfront: ‘wireless’ in this context usually means the camera to the monitor, not your entire car’s electrical system becoming a ghost. You’ll still have power cables. The real magic is avoiding that spaghetti junction running from your trunk to your dashboard. And that, my friends, is where the devil hides in the details. I spent around $350 testing three different ‘wireless’ kits before I found one that didn’t drop signal every time I hit a pothole. Seven out of ten people I talked to had the same issue with their first purchase.

The transmitter and receiver communicate wirelessly, which sounds great. But the quality of that signal can be a coin toss. You want a kit that uses a robust frequency, not one that’s easily drowned out by your car’s own electronics or nearby radio interference. Think of it like trying to have a quiet conversation at a rock concert.

Picking the Right Kit: Don’t Get Fooled by Fancy Boxes

Look, I’m not going to recommend specific brands because they change faster than a politician’s promises. But here’s the real-world advice: check reviews that mention signal stability and actual installation difficulty. Avoid kits that boast about 1080p resolution but have zero real-world user feedback on the wireless performance. A slightly lower resolution that has a rock-solid connection is infinitely better than crystal-clear video that cuts out when you need it most. The camera itself needs to be weatherproof, obviously, but pay attention to the transmitter’s casing too. It’s going to be exposed to the elements, and a flimsy plastic box is a recipe for disaster. I’ve seen them corrode in less than a year.

Here’s a quick rundown of what actually matters:

Feature What to Look For My Verdict
Wireless Frequency 2.4GHz is common, but look for kits that specify better shielding or dual-band options if you have a lot of other wireless tech in your car. Signal stability is KING. Don’t compromise here.
Power Source Camera needs power (usually reverse light). Monitor needs power (usually cigarette lighter or wired into accessory power). Tap into accessory power for the monitor if possible, it’s cleaner. Cigarette lighter is easy but can be clunky.
Night Vision Infrared LEDs are standard. Check how many and how powerful they are. Crucial for parking in the dark. Test this feature thoroughly.
Mounting Options Surface mount, license plate frame mount, or flush mount. License plate frame is usually the easiest for DIY without drilling.
Monitor Size/Type Stand-alone screen or integrated into a rearview mirror. Mirror replacements can look slicker but are often more complex to wire. Stand-alone is usually simpler.

The Actual ‘how-To’ (the Part Where You Might Sweat)

Alright, deep breaths. You’ve got your kit. You’ve decided where the camera will live – usually above the license plate is the sweet spot for visibility. If you’re mounting to the trunk lid or bumper, you’ll need to find a way to get the transmitter’s wire inside the car. This often involves drilling a small hole, which sounds scary, but with a good drill bit and some sealant, it’s perfectly manageable. Use a grommet to protect the wire. The sound of the drill bit biting into metal is surprisingly loud, and you can almost feel the vibration travel up your arm.

Step 1: Power the Camera. This is almost always tapped into your reverse light. You’ll need to get to the wiring harness for the reverse lights. This might mean removing some trim panels in the trunk or rear bumper area. Watch a video specific to your car model if you can. It’s a pain, but it’s doable. Some kits come with clever ‘add-a-circuit’ connectors that make this less intimidating. These little metal tabs are surprisingly fiddly.

Step 2: Mount the Transmitter. Once the camera is wired up, the transmitter usually plugs directly into it. Find a dry, relatively protected spot inside the trunk or near the rear bumper for the transmitter. Secure it with zip ties or double-sided automotive tape.

Step 3: Run Power to the Monitor. This is the ‘wireless’ part being a bit of a fib. You need to get power to the monitor up front. The easiest way is usually to run the cable along the floorboards, tucked under the carpet or plastic trim panels. This requires prying up some trim, which can feel like you’re breaking your car, but most of it just pops off if you’re gentle. The plastic trim pieces can creak ominously when you first pull them.

Step 4: Connect the Monitor. Plug the power cable into the monitor and then into your car’s power source (cigarette lighter or accessory fuse tap). If you’re tapping a fuse, get an add-a-circuit fuse holder. This is where my first kit failed spectacularly; I didn’t secure the transmitter well enough, and the constant vibration from driving caused the antenna to work loose. Total disaster on a long road trip.

Step 5: Test and Secure. Turn on your ignition, put the car in reverse. The monitor should light up and show the camera feed. If it doesn’t, retrace your steps. Check all connections. Once it’s working, tidy up all the wires. Use zip ties, electrical tape, and cable management clips to make it look neat and prevent rattles. Nobody wants a flapping wire sound every time they turn.

Common Pitfalls and How to Dodge Them

Everyone says to just tap into the reverse light. Simple, right? Wrong. For some cars, the reverse light wiring is really tricky to access without major disassembly. My buddy’s BMW required removing half the trunk liner. My own SUV was easier, but I still spent over an hour fumbling around in the dark. The smell of old car carpet isn’t exactly pleasant.

Contrarian Opinion: Many guides suggest running the monitor’s power wire all the way to the fuse box. Honestly, if your kit has a cigarette lighter adapter, just use that unless you’re really bothered by the cable. The hassle of tapping into the fuse box correctly can sometimes outweigh the aesthetic gain, especially for a beginner. It’s like trying to perfectly fold a fitted sheet – sometimes ‘good enough’ is actually better.

Another thing: interference. If your camera feed is choppy, try relocating the transmitter or monitor. Sometimes simply rotating the transmitter 90 degrees can make a world of difference. It’s like adjusting an antenna on an old TV.

If you’re buying a kit that includes drilling a hole, make sure it comes with a rubber grommet. If it doesn’t, buy one. Seriously. Going without a grommet means the raw metal edge of the hole will eventually chafe through the wire, and then you’re back to square one, but with a hole in your car.

Do I Need to Drill Holes to Install a Wireless Backup Camera?

Possibly, but not always. Most kits are designed to mount onto your license plate frame, which requires no drilling. However, you will need to get the power wire from the camera’s transmitter inside the vehicle, which might involve drilling a small hole for the wire to pass through the trunk lid or bumper, though some clever routing might avoid this in certain vehicles. You’ll likely need to drill a small hole for the camera’s power wire to pass through the trunk lid or bumper if you’re mounting it directly.

How Do I Power the Camera and Monitor?

The camera typically draws power from your car’s reverse light circuit, so it only turns on when you shift into reverse. The monitor usually plugs into your car’s 12V accessory socket (cigarette lighter) or can be wired into the car’s fuse box using an ‘add-a-circuit’ fuse tap for a cleaner installation that’s always powered or on with accessory power.

Will a Wireless Backup Camera Work in the Dark?

Most decent wireless backup cameras come equipped with infrared (IR) LEDs. These LEDs emit invisible light that illuminates the area behind your car, allowing the camera to see in complete darkness. The effectiveness of the night vision depends on the number and quality of these LEDs.

What If the Wireless Signal Keeps Cutting Out?

Signal interference is the most common issue with wireless systems. This can be caused by other electronic devices in your car, the length and routing of your wires, or even the weather. Try repositioning the transmitter and receiver, using shielded cables if possible, or consider a wired backup camera system if the interference is persistent and severe. Sometimes, just ensuring the transmitter’s antenna is pointing in the right direction can help.

Can I Install a Wireless Backup Camera Myself?

Yes, in most cases. While it involves some basic automotive wiring and potentially removing trim panels, it’s a manageable DIY project for many people. Kits are designed for user installation. If you’re uncomfortable with basic tools or automotive electrics, it’s worth the cost of a professional installation, which typically runs between $100-$200.
